Province 1 Assembly adjourned in three minutes



BIRATNAGAR: The first meeting of the winter session of Province 1 has been postponed only after three minutes of its start.

According to sources, the meeting was adjourned after reading a letter from the Province Chief convening the session.

Earlier the national anthem was played in the hall. Immediately after reading the letter of the province chief, the Speaker informed that the meeting was postponed.

Prior to this, a meeting of the task management advisory committee had decided not to let the leaders of any faction of Nepal Communist Party speak in today’s session.

Generally, on the day the winter session of the province assembly begins, the leaders representing various parties are allowed to address the assembly.
